Claims
- 1. A variant polypeptide having laccase activity and improved stability as compared to a parent laccase, wherein said parent laccase has the amino acid sequence depicted in SEQ ID No. 1 or has an amino acid sequence at least 80% homologous to SEQ ID No. 1. and wherein said variant polypetide comprises a mutation at one or more positions corresponding to positions selected from the group consisting of Trp13, Tyr17, Tyr23, Tyr36, Trp46, Met58, Trp73, Trp94, Trp136, Tyr137, Tyr145, Tyr175, Tyr176, Tyr177, Tyr214, Met254, Met260, Tyr273, Tyr286, Trp287, Tyr305, Trp384, Tyr391, Tyr403, Trp414, Tyr416, Trp417, Tyr441, Met480, Trp486, Tyr517, Trp543, Tyr546, Trp547, Tyr552, Trp563, and Trp569 of SEO ID NO: 1 or equivalent positions thereof in said homologous parent laccase sequences.
- 2. A variant polypeptide according to claim 1, wherein said position is selected from the group consisting of: Trp136, Tyr145, Met480, Tyr137, Tyr176, Met254, and combinations of any of the foregoing.
- 3. A variant polypeptide according to claim 1, wherein the parent laccase is derived from Myceliophthora.
- 4. A variant polypeptide according to claim 1, wherein the parent laccase is derived from Scytalidium.
- 5. A variant polypeptide according to claim 4, wherein the parent laccase is a Scytalidium thermophilum laccase with the sequence ID No. 2.
- 6. A variant according to claim 5, which comprises a mutation in a position corresponding to a position in SEQ ID No. 2 selected from the group consisting of: Trp181, Tyr190, Met530, Tyr182, Tyr221, Met300, Met313, and combinations of any of the foregoing.
- 7. A detergent additive comprising a variant polypeptide according to claim 1 in the form of a non-dusting granulate, a stabilised liquid or a protected enzyme.
- 8. A detergent additive according to claim 7, further comprising one or more other enzymes selected from the group consisting of a protease, a lipase, an amylase, and a cellulase.
- 9. A detergent composition comprising a variant polypeptide according to claim 1 and a surfactant.
- 10. A detergent composition according to claim 9 further comprising one or more other enzymes selected from the group consisting of a protease, a lipase, an amylase and a cellulase.
